**Company and Market Position**
Operating a cloud-based AI and data products platform, Domo connects individuals across an organization, from executives to frontline employees, granting access to real-time insights and data management tools. The company’s platform is designed for seamless accessibility, supporting a wide range of devices, from laptops to smartphones. Strategic partnerships, like the one with Altis Consulting, augment Domo’s offering by delivering data solutions that drive smarter decisions and measurable outcomes.
Despite its innovative platform and strategic partnerships, Domo’s market cap stands at a modest $607.75 million. This places the company in a unique position within the tech sector, as it strives to expand its influence across key regions including North America, Western Europe, and Asia-Pacific markets like Japan and India.
**Valuation and Financial Performance**
Domo’s valuation metrics present a mixed bag for potential investors. The company’s trailing P/E ratio is not available, and its forward P/E ratio is an eye-watering 737.00, indicating that the market has high expectations for its future earnings growth. However, these metrics may reflect the transitional phase that many tech companies experience as they scale operations and optimize profitability.
Revenue growth is relatively modest at 1.70%, but a positive free cash flow of $56.16 million highlights Domo’s ability to generate cash and potentially reinvest in its growth initiatives. The company is yet to turn a net profit, with an EPS of -1.95, which should prompt investors to consider the balance between current performance and future growth potential.

**Technical Analysis Insights**
From a technical perspective, Domo’s stock is trading below its 50-day moving average of $15.64, yet remains above the 200-day moving average of $11.22. This positioning might indicate a temporary dip within a longer-term upward trend. The RSI (14) of 68.96 is approaching overbought territory, which could signal potential caution for short-term traders. Additionally, the MACD of -0.19 compared to its signal line of 0.08 suggests potential bearish momentum in the short term.
